Recall for Milwaukee Top Handle Chainsaws

Safety Update Oct 30th 2025

Recall & Safety Notice: Milwaukee Tool, in cooperation with the U.S. Consumer Product Safety Commission (CPSC), is voluntarily recalling a subset of M18 FUEL™ Top Handle Chainsaws (category number 2826-20) due to a potential chain brake issue. Affected Serial Numbers are distinguished by the fourth serial code letter, ‘A’. If you have an affected unit, stop using the saw immediately and send the equipment in for free repair. See https://www.milwaukeetool.com/support/recall for more information.


On some saws (units with the fourth character of the serial number “A”), the chain brake may not prevent the chain from moving when the brake is engaged. Failure of the brake could pose a laceration risk should the chain be contacted by the operator. Kit Configurations: 2826-20T, 2826-21T, 2826-22T, 2826-20C

Affected Serial numbers: Units with the fourth character of the serial number is “A.” Affected Units were shipped from Milwaukee Tool to Distribution partners from:

The only affected saw is the M18 FUEL™ Top Handle Chainsaw
If you have an affected saw:
• Stop using the saw immediately.
• Arrange for free repair by:
• Utilizing the eService portal
• Or by calling 833-953-2012 (7:00am to 4:30pm Central Standard Time, Monday through Friday)
• If your serial number is unreadable, stop using the saw immediately and arrange for free repair.
